Tomorrow Comes  is a very unique look at life after death. Written by Donna Mebane after her young adult daughter died very unexpectedly, the book follows Emma as she wakes up in a world that is familiar, yet unfamiliar at the same time. The book is a powerful narrative, at times light, at times heartbreaking, and offer insight into the grieving process.

The overall tone of the book is hopeful, even if there are sad moments throughout. Based on the true love and loss experienced by the author, there is a lot of feeling and emotion in the book. It's worth the read for anyone who has lost someone suddenly.
